K751 TKH is a 1994 Mazda 121 in Red with a 1,324c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 2 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1994 Mazda 121 models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.0% with a typical mileage of 79,563 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mazda 121 f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 4,459 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K751 TKH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mazda 121 typ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 32 years old, this Mazda 121 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
